rather than using up paper, ink/toner, and space ...
i recommend you download your messages to your computer.
then you can not only keep the ones you want but organize them in any number of ways.
if you use the .csv format the file will open in most spreadsheet applications.
that format can also be imported easily to a database application.

If you hit your control key (ctl) and p key at the same time......it will usually print your screen, take care if your printer gives you and option and you do not want to print out pages of comments, specify your printer to print only pages 1-3 for instance.
